The Atlanta Falcons signed 22 undrafted rookie free agents in the wake of 2012 NFL Drafts' conclusion Saturday. The Falcons pulled prospects from all over the map, from Minnesota-Mankato and Kutztown to Alabama and Miami. One of the more intriguing players may be Oregon State's James Rodgers, the older brother of current Falcons running back Jacquizz. James finished his career with the Beavers as the school's all-time leader with 6,377 all-purpose yards.
